#8c50e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8c50e4 is composed of 54.9% red, 31.4%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.6% cyan, 64.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 264.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 60.4%. #8c50e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#1900c9.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#8c50e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8c50e4 has RGB values of R:140, G:80,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 9195748.

Shades and Tints of #8c50e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06020c is the darkest color, while #fcf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8c50e4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99969e is the less saturated color, while #8839fb is the most saturated one.
